Netzwerkdrucker lahmt

Seit der Installation von Service Pack 2 legt Windows XP minutenlange Pausen ein, wenn ich drucken möchte. Der Drucker ist an einem Linux-Server mit Samba angeschlossen, und das Systray-Icon für die WLAN-Verbindung zeigt während dieser Wartezeiten ununterbrochenen Datenverkehr an. Auch beim Start mancher Anwendungen (zum Beispiel OpenOffice) kommt es zu langen Verzögerungen und damit einhergehendem Netzverkehr.

vorlesen Druckansicht
Lesezeit: 1 Min.
Von
  • Dr. Harald Bögeholz

Seit der Installation von Service Pack 2 legt Windows XP minutenlange Pausen ein, wenn ich drucken möchte. Der Drucker ist an einem Linux-Server mit Samba angeschlossen, und das Systray-Icon für die WLAN-Verbindung zeigt während dieser Wartezeiten ununterbrochenen Datenverkehr an. Auch beim Start mancher Anwendungen (zum Beispiel OpenOffice) kommt es zu langen Verzögerungen und damit einhergehendem Netzverkehr.

Wir haben solch einen Fall auch schon einmal beobachtet und dabei mit Ethereal den Netzwerkverkehr mitgeschnitten. Dabei gingen beim Start von OpenOffice sage und schreibe 50 MByte an Daten ĂĽber die WLAN-Verbindung - bei einem WLAN mit 802.11b (11 MBit/s) also kein Wunder, dass das eine Minute dauert. Windows schien sich dabei mit dem Samba-Server angeregt ĂĽber die Frage nach dem optimalen Druckertreiber zu unterhalten.

Neuere Windows-Versionen verwenden eine RPC-basierte Schnittstelle, um Druckertreiber automatisch vom Server zu beziehen und zu aktualisieren. Wenn diese Funktion nicht benötigt wird, lässt sie sich in der Samba-Konfiguration mit der Zeile

disable spoolss = yes

im Abschnitt [global] abschalten. In unserem Fall verschwand damit der überflüssige Netzverkehr und mit ihm die lästigen Wartezeiten. (bo)